摘要
Optimum use of the cutting tool is a growing need in modern industries. The objective of the present work is to evaluate the optimal cutting conditions with the minimum number of experiments. To determine the optimal conditions the tool-life equation should be well defined. A model has been developed for evaluating the Taylorian Exponent n and constant C using the minimum number of experiments. This model has been used for developing an adaptive control system for on-line monitoring of tool wear. Experiments were carried out to determine the tool-life by correlating the increase in the cutting force with tool wear. The model would be useful to industries where the tool and work material change frequently and the performance is sensitively dependent upon the optimal cutting conditions.
